Wagner a Double Winner at Antioch Speedway

by ECT

Antioch, CA — Danny Wagner won his first 20 lap All Star Series Winged 360 Sprint Car Main Event Saturday night at Antioch Speedway. Earlier the evening, Wagner also won the 20 lap A Modified Main Event. Wagner is driving the Dave Johnson owned Sprint Car this season.

The Main Event had a rough start with three yellow flags in the first lap, and two-time champion Art McCarthy set the pace when the race finally got going. Wagner made an inside pass on the backstretch on lap three to take second from Ryon Nelson. Wagner quickly closed in on McCarthy and begin looking for a way around. A high pass in Turn 3 of the 10th lap finally gained Wagner the lead. As Wagner begin to pull away, McCarthy saw a late challenge from reigning champion Matt DeMartini. DeMartini made an inside move in Turn 3 of the 18th lap, but there was slight contact as DeMartini gained the position. McCarthy fell a few positions back as Wagner won ahead of DeMartini, Roberto Kirby, Jacob Tuttle and McCarthy.

Danny Wagner also won his second 20 lap A Modified Main Event to gain a little bit more ground on point leader Buddy Kniss. There was a restart after contact sent Michelle Paul spinning in Turn 2. Officials penalized Raymond Linderman to the rear for the restart, and Wagner jumped into the lead at the waiving of the green flag. Multi time Petaluma champion Michael Paul Jr settled into second on lap two with Bobby Motts Jr gaining third a lap later. By then, Wagner had a straightaway advantage. Wagner caught slower traffic by lap 10, and though he was slowed up just a little bit, once he cleared the traffic, he pulled away again. Wagner scored an impressive victory in the non-stop race, followed by Michael Paul Jr, Motts, Oreste Gonella and Buddy Kniss.

Kevin Brown won his first career 20 lap B Modified Main Event. Brown had the outside front row starting position and raced into the lead at the start ahead of Mark Garner and Tommy Clymens Jr. Point leader Tommy Fraser made a backstretch pass on Clymens for third on lap three. As the lead two cars ran down the back stretch on lap 10, contact sent Brown sideways into the infield as Garner gained the lead over Fraser and Chris Sieweke. Contact from Sieweke sent Fraser spinning in Turn 3 for a lap 15 yellow flag. Moments later, Garner had his motor let go on him in a big cloud of smoke. This put Brown back into the lead. After another yellow flag on the restart, Brown led Fraser and Sieweke on the next restart. Fraser pressured Brown hard and just managed beat him back to the line at the white flag. However, Brown had the better outside line and had the lead by the time they exited Turn 2. Brown went on to win ahead of Fraser, Sieweke, Clymens and Cameron Swank.

David Michael Rosa won his first 20 lap Dwarf Car Main Event of the season. Rosa had the outside front row starting spot and charged into the early lead over Troy Stevenson Jr. Point leader Scott Dahlgren briefly gained third on lap four, but hard charger Devan Kammermann regained the position a lap later. Kammermann quickly set his sites on Stevenson and gained second on lap six. During the closing laps, Kammermann was making a challenge on Rosa for the lead when a yellow flag waved on lap 18. Rosa got a good start and would take it all the way to the checkered flag. Kammermann held off a late challenge from teammate Dahlgren to finish second as Bobby Johnson and Stevenson completed the Top 5.
